Hi

I would like to estimate how long building the rust toolchain would take on my 2-c 2.2 Ghz laptop.

I asked on irc and had an idea of improvement:
<rekado_> swedebugia: you can check the build duration for past builds on ci.guix.gnu.org <rekado_> most of the build nodes are pretty old and weak, though probably still faster than a 2-core celeron. <rekado_> (we’re currently finalising the order for a replacement of all but two build nodes)
<swedebugia> rekado_, wow new fast nodes :)
* bzp har avslutat (Quit: Lost terminal)
<swedebugia> Maybe we could have an additional time measurement: Ghzminutes. E.g. if the build took 60 minutes on a 3 Ghz machine it took 20 Ghzminutes. <swedebugia> The build node would have to communicate the total Ghz used for the build. E.g. if 2-core 3 Ghz= 2*3 Ghz= 6 Ghz.

Any thoughts about this?
